1. Self-Assessment
Before diving into the job market, take the time to assess your skills, interests, values, and goals. Identify your strengths and weaknesses to determine the areas where you excel and where you may need further development. Understanding yourself better will help you align your career path with your aspirations.
2. Set Clear Goals
Define your short-term and long-term career goals. Consider where you see yourself in five years and what steps you need to take to get there. Setting spec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als will provide you with a roadmap for your career progression.
3. Skill Development
Continuous learning and skill development are crucial for staying competitive in today's job market. Identify the skills required in your desired field and seek opportunities to acquire or enhance them. This could include formal education, certifications, workshops, or online courses.
4. Networking
Building a professional network can significantly impact your career advancement. Attend industry events, connect with professionals on platforms like LinkedIn, and seek mentorship opportunities. Networking can lead to job referrals, insights into the industry, and valuable connections.
5. Job Search Strategies
When searching for job opportunities, utilize a variety of strategies to maximize your chances of success:
- Customize your resume and cover letter for each application.
- Use online job boards, company websites, and professional networking sites.
- Attend career fairs and industry-specific events.
- Utilize recruitment agencies and staffing firms.
- Tap into your network for referrals and recommendations.
6. Interview Preparation
Prepare for job interviews by researching the company, practicing common interview questions, and showcasing your skills and experiences effectively. Dress professionally, arrive on time, and follow up with a thank-you note after the interview.
